PVC Window Hinge Repairs: A Comprehensive GuidePVC windows are a popular option for house owners due to their energy effectiveness, resilience, and low upkeep requirements. However, like all mechanical elements, the hinges can wear out or become harmed over time. Effectively operating hinges are essential for guaranteeing that windows operate efficiently and firmly. Window Hinge Maintenance Tips will supply an in-depth summary of PVC window hinge repair work, consisting of common issues, repair techniques, and often asked concerns.Understanding PVC Window HingesPVC window hinges are developed to hold the window in location while permitting smooth opening and closing. There are mainly two types of hinges utilized in PVC windows: Hook Hinges: These are frequently used in casement windows and provide robust assistance.Side Hinges: These are typically found in tilt-and-turn windows, enabling for versatile opening alternatives.Typical Issues with PVC Window HingesWith time, hinges might encounter numerous problems that can affect window operation. Some typical problems include:Rust: Although PVC hinges resist rust, some metal components may rust or degrade.Misalignment: Hinges can end up being misaligned due to use and tear, affecting the window's fit.Breakage: Plastic hinges can break under stress or if subjected to heavy winds or effects.Squeaking: Lack of lubrication can cause bothersome squeaks during window operation.The following table sums up the common problems and their possible causes:IssuePossible CausesRustWorn away metal parts, moisture direct exposureMisalignmentRoutine usage, effect, or incorrect installationBreakageHigh stress, extreme climate conditionSqueakingAbsence of lubricationActions for Repairing PVC Window HingesFixing PVC window hinges can typically be a simple process. Here are the steps that can be taken to repair typical hinge issues:1. Examine the HingesBefore starting any repair work, it's necessary to inspect the hinges for signs of wear or damage. Look for rust, flexes, or other deformities.2. Tighten Up Loose ScrewsTypically, loose screws can cause misalignment. Utilize a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ws on the hinges.3. Straighten Misaligned HingesIf the window is not closing effectively, the hinges might require realignment. Change the hinge position: Loosen the screws slightly, change the hinge to the correct position, and after that re-tighten.Check the frame: Sometimes, the issue might also be with the window frame, requiring modifications there.4. Lubricate HingesTo deal with squeaking, use an appropriate lubricant (like silicone spray) to the hinges. This ought to assist get rid of sound and improve operation.5. Change Damaged HingesIf the hinge is broken or significantly used, it may need to be replaced. Steps for Replacement:Remove the screws holding the harmed hinge.Separate the hinge from the window frame.Connect the brand-new hinge in the same position, ensuring it is aligned correctly.Secure with screws and check the operation of the window.6. Look For Professional HelpIf the repairs feel beyond your skills or if the hinges continue to malfunction, it's a good idea to consult a professional.
